Donovan is 1-9 against Momence since October of 2017 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Thursday. The Wildcats will face off against the Momence Athletics at 6:00 p.m. Momence took a loss in their last matchup and will be looking to turn the tables on Donovan, who comes in off a win.
Donovan took a loss when they played away from home on Thursday, but their home fans gave them all the motivation they needed on Tuesday. They walked away with a 2-0 victory over Illinois Lutheran. The win was a breath of fresh air for the Wildcats as it put an end to their six-match losing streak.
Donovan never let Illinois Lutheran on the board, but things got pretty close in the first set. The final score came out to 26-24, 25-13.
Donovan relied on the efforts of Chloe Ponton, who had seven digs and two aces, and Lily Anderson, who had 17 assists and five digs.
They weren't the only good servers: Donovan was lethal from the service line and finished the match with ten aces. They are 5-1 when they serve at least ten aces.
Meanwhile, Momence came up short against St. Anne on Tuesday and fell 2-0.
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-16, 25-18.
Momence's loss dropped their record down to 4-15. As for Donovan, their victory bumped their record up to 8-11.
Donovan beat Momence 2-0 in their previous matchup back in September. Will the Wildcats repeat their success, or do the Momence Athletics have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
